Aldar’s Mandarin Oriental Residences over 50% reserved as global buyers eye Abu Dhabi property market
Abu Dhabi developer Aldar Properties has secured reservations for more than half of the first residential building in its upcoming Mandarin Oriental branded development through off-market sales, as the emirate’s cultural district continues to attract ultra-wealthy global investors, a senior executive told Arabian Business.

Toto Wolff: Lewis Hamilton could’ve fought for Abu Dhabi F1 win without Q1 exit
Mercedes boss Toto Wolff believes Lewis Hamilton held the pace to challenge for the win in the Formula 1 Abu Dhabi Grand Prix had he started higher up on the grid. Hamilton starred on his last appearance with Mercedes as he produced a superb drive at the Yas Marina Circuit to recover 12 places to come home in fourth position.
